read the original abstract

The twist polynomial of a delta-matroid was recently introduced by Yan and Jin, who proved a characterization of binary delta-matroids with twist monomials. In this paper, we extend this result to all delta-matroids by proving that any delta-matroid with a twist monomial must be binary.
